Default Walden Preserve

I had the opportunity to visit a preserve in a nearby town, that is somewhat famous for its abundance of butterflies and birds. Mostly meadows with shoulder high grasses and weeds, and loaded with wild flowers. I found a lot more butterflies than I was able to capture. Thought I'd share some of what I found.

Least Skipper (Ancyloxpha numitor)



Monarch Butterfly (Danaus plexippus)



Little Wood-satyr



Ebony Jewelwing (Calopteryx maculata)



tattered American Lady (Vanessa virginiensis)



Cabbage White (Pieris rapae)



Eastern Tiger Swallowtail (Papilio glaucus)
